Large Size Book, 1st Printing.The congressman from the Ninth District in Michigan, Guy Vander Jagt, has given the word "orator" a new, extended application in contemporary American politics. His understanding of communication skills was pivotal in bringing the Republican Party from the brink of disaster in 1974 to its present position of power and prominence. When most political pundits were writing the GOP off as a ghost of past glories, Vander Jagt was digging in as chairman of the National Republican Congressional Committee to rebuild it, to change it from an almost defunct political organization to what is recognized as the "best political shop" in the country. This he did in half a decade. In addition, even when the White House became Democratic in 1976, Vander Jagt's voice was heard on the campaign trail as a call to arms rallying Republicans and stirring Americans everywhere to support a "new beginning" with a new president. After 1980, President Reagan called upon Vander Jagt's communication skills to increase Republican strength in the House. Working together, congressional Republicans and the White House changed the direction of American government.
